Today’s Star Spangled Salute honor British World War II Veteran Captain Sir Tom Moore.  What Captain Moore did at the beginning of the pandemic in Britain during the height of the first wave was inspiring to the world.  You’ll remember that during lock down he walked around his garden with his walker and raised $53 million dollars for the National Health Service of England.  He spread joy, and shared a message with the world that the sun would shine again and that the clouds would clear.  He was even knighted by Queen Elizabeth.  After battling skin and prostate cancer for several years and recently being admitted to the hospital for Covid-19, Sir Tom Moore has died at the age of 100.  Thank you for your joy and positivity Tom and THANK YOU for your service.
